Graduate and Professional School Preparation

If a bachelor's degree doesn't represent the end of your educational plans, you've come to the right place. A Case undergraduate education prepares you for success at the next level. Most Case graduates go on to earn some type of an advanced degree. Some enter a graduate or professional school program directly upon graduation, while others choose to work, volunteer, travel, (or rest!) for a couple years in between.  

A host of resources are available to students planning to further their study. Academic advisors offer guidance on appropriate next steps for your academic and career goals. Our career center also offers individual advising as well as a credentials service to help you manage your applications for graduate school. Many of our students take advantage of Case's outstanding undergraduate research opportunities to gain a better understanding of their field, as well as to get a leg up on other applicants.

Case also has dedicated advisers for pre-med, pre-dentistry, and pre-law students, as well as those planning on going to a graduate business school. And the undergraduate studies office assists you with applications for national fellowships and scholarships to help fund advanced study.
